Output dec40233017b3f1296309a957ad42ca7a525a9418376ab28c17d87888cec16a7:8

value
2606462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561cd3f4d71c3c6d352b41568becd2c546e4f560 OP_EQUAL
address
39YLa3RVF3Yqbf3kPrJspprXcbG2rbG2YU
transaction
dec40233017b3f1296309a957ad42ca7a525a9418376ab28c17d87888cec16a7
spent
true